Business lawyers in Laramie Wyoming assist with entity formation contract review and commercial disputes. Wyoming law offers unique benefits like no corporate income tax and strong asset protection for LLCs. Local attorneys understand the needs of businesses in Albany County and the broader state.
What Does a Business Lawyer in Laramie Cost?
Typical costs for a business lawyer in Wyoming range from 200 to 400 dollars per hour. Flat fees for LLC formation often range from 500 to 1,500 dollars. Contract review may cost 500 to 2,000 dollars depending on complexity. Costs vary by case and attorney experience. This is general information and not legal advice.

Frequently Asked Questions
What types of business entities can a lawyer help me form in Laramie?
A business lawyer in Laramie can help you form LLCs corporations partnerships and sole proprietorships. Wyoming LLCs are popular due to low annual fees and privacy protections. Your lawyer will file the required articles with the Wyoming Secretary of State.
Does Wyoming require a business lawyer for a commercial lease review?
Wyoming does not legally require a lawyer for lease review but it is highly recommended. A lawyer can identify unfavorable terms and ensure compliance with Wyoming landlord tenant laws. This can save you from costly disputes later.
What is the statute of limitations for breach of contract claims in Wyoming?
In Wyoming the statute of limitations for a written contract claim is 10 years under Wyoming Statute 1-3-105. For oral contracts it is 8 years. A business lawyer can help you meet these deadlines and preserve your rights.
